No Maximus i'm sponsoring my husband but i'm in Pakistan right now.

CAIPS will only be issued to you if you are living in Canada.  Otherwise, you have to have them released to someone living in Canada.  For that, you need to ensure you sign and submit the proper authorizations.

You can just print the request form online at:

http://www.cic.gc.ca/english/pdf/kits/forms/IMM5563B.pdf


"Authority to Release Personal Information" http://www.cic.gc.ca/english/pdf/kits/forms/IMM5475E.pdf form.  Include it with the "Access to Information Request" form.

Send both of these forms and a cheque for $5 payable to the Receiver General of Canada to:

Citizenship and Immigration Canada
Access to Information and Privacy Coordinator
Narono Building
360 Laurier Avenue West, 10th Floor
Ottawa, Ontario K1A 1L1
